Criteria: work is measurable, reproducible, and adjustable: test conditions and results are comparable and repeatable, test tolerated by healthy people, low learning factor, low risk. Involves large muscle groups (2/3 of musculature: you have to have enough lean muscle mass to maximize component of the cardiovascular system technique component and skill component should be minimum while conducting cardiorespiratory fitness (not overly complicated) Pre-test control: before any aerobic power test: Resting bp below 144/94 mmhg (minimum bp = 80/50) No alcohol 8 hours before test it is a depressant that will decrease hr. No smoking 2 hours before test it is a stimulant that will increase hr. No caffeine 6 hours before test also a stimulant. Criteria for stopping a test (physical symptoms) Rapid or laboured breathing (dyspnea), at low work rates you have high ventilation at low work rates you stop the test.
